WebNov 7, 2014 · The economic literature has shown that all rigorous definitions of neglect of the future involve the use of higher than “desirable” interest rates. To explore the consequences of such interest rates, one requires a theory of how resource producers act. Such guidance is provided by the Gray-Hotelling pure theory of exhaustion. WebSep 8, 2010 · This article provides a comprehensive survey of models of dynamic games in the exploitation of renewable and exhaustible resources. It includes dynamic games at the industry level (oligopoly, cartel versus fringe, tragedy of the commons) and at the international level (tariffs on exhaustible resources, fish wars, entry deterrence). …
